What Exactly Is Paper Stars?

Paper Stars is a handwritten font designed to mimic the natural, slightly uneven look of real hand lettering. Unlike rigid, mechanical fonts, it carries the charm of pen on paper—complete with subtle variations in stroke weight and playful loops. The overall style is cute and friendly, but not overly childish, which makes it versatile enough for a wide range of creative work. Whether you are a hobbyist crafter or a small business owner designing products for print-on-demand, Paper Stars offers a casual yet polished aesthetic.

The font includes standard u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and common punctuation. Some versions may also feature alternate characters or ligatures, giving you even more control over the final look. Because it is a handwritten font, it works beautifully when you want to convey a sense of authenticity, joy, or handmade care.

Where Can Paper Stars Be Used? Real-World Applications

One of the biggest strengths of Paper Stars is its flexibility. It is not confined to one niche. Below are some of the most popular applications, each with a short scenario to show how it works in practice.

Crafts and DIY Projects

Imagine creating a set of handmade gift tags for a birthday party. You cut out cardstock shapes and use your Cricut to write names with Paper Stars. The font’s playful loops make each tag feel unique, as if you had penned them yourself. This same approach works for scrapbook titles, custom tote bags, or hand-stamped designs on clay.

Planner Stickers and Digital Planning

For bullet journal enthusiasts and digital planner users, Paper Stars adds a cozy, handwritten vibe to sticker sheets. You can design weekly headers, habit trackers, and motivational quotes using the font. Printed on sticker paper and cut with a Cricut, these stickers bring a cohesive look to any planner. In digital planning apps like GoodNotes, the font feels natural when typed into text boxes.

KDP (Kindle Direct Publishing) and Print-on-Demand

Self-published authors and POD sellers often need covers and interiors that stand out. Paper Stars is excellent for children’s book covers, activity books, coloring book titles, and motivational journals. A notebook cover that reads “Dream Big” in Paper Stars conveys warmth and approachability, which can attract buyers looking for something heartfelt.

Greeting Cards and Stationery

Whether you are designing birthday cards, thank-you notes, or wedding place cards, Paper Stars gives your text a handmade elegance. Pair it with a simple illustration and you have a card that feels personal without requiring hours of calligraphy practice. Greeting card makers on Etsy frequently use this font for inside messages and envelope addressing.

Sublimation and Heat Transfer Projects

Sublimation on mugs, tumblers, or T-shirts requires fonts that look good at various sizes. Paper Stars holds up well because the letterforms are not too thin or too intricate. A mug with a bright “Coffee & Creativity” message in Paper Stars will look hand-lettered and charming.

Cricut and Cutting Machine Projects

Cricut users love Paper Stars for its clean outlines that are easy to weld and cut. You can create iron-on vinyl designs for tote bags, wall decals, or wood signs. The font’s playful style means even simple words like “Hello” or “Welcome” become focal points.

How to Evaluate Whether Paper Stars Suits Your Project

Before you download or purchase Paper Stars, ask yourself a few questions to determine if it is the right match.

  1. What is the tone of your project? If you need warmth, playfulness, or a handmade feel, Paper Stars is an excellent choice. For serious, formal, or technical content, look elsewhere.
  2. How will the font be used? For short display text, it excels. For lengthy paragraphs, consider a more readable option.
  3. Who is your audience? If you are targeting young children, hobbyists, or people who appreciate cute aesthetics, this font will resonate. For a corporate audience, it may feel out of place.
  4. Are you printing or cutting? Check that the font’s lines are thick enough for your cutting machine. Thin strokes can be difficult to weed or align.
  5. Do you have a complementary font in mind? Having a neutral secondary font can elevate the design and prevent visual fatigue.
  6. What is your budget? Paper Stars may be available for free with limited commercial rights or as a paid font with extended licensing. Compare options to match your needs.

Testing the font in a mockup before committing to a large project is always a good idea. Many font marketplaces allow you to type a preview with your own words. Use that feature to see how Paper Stars handles your specific text.
